Grace Covenant Community School At First Mennonite in Richmond, VA serves 36 students from pre鈥搆indergarten through fourth grade in a suburban setting.
Founded in 1905, this co鈥揺ducational school offers a nonsectarian elementary education with a student body representing 43.75 percent students of color.
The school operates with one teacher and has a student鈥搕eacher ratio of 36:1.
Grace Covenant is among the oldest private schools in Virginia, reflecting a long鈥搒tanding educational presence in the Richmond suburb.
